On Thu, Feb 21, 2019 at 12:08:07AM +0100, Andreas Enge wrote:
> It looks as if ssh-keygen takes too long; this is called from
> openssh-activation in services/ssh.scm, with a comment
> "Generate missing host keys". Are these regenerated at each boot?
> If yes, is there a race condition, one action not waiting for the
> previous one to finish?

The host keys should not be regenerated on each boot.  Wouldn't we
notice if they were, since our SSH clients would complain about them
having changed?
